The Week in Recalls: Week of November 14, 2025

The following product recalls have been announced this week—make sure you’re in the know.
ByHeart Whole Nutrition Infant Formula and Anywhere Packs
ByHeart is recalling its Whole Nutrition Infant Formula and Anywhere Pack pouches of powdered formula due to an expanding outbreak of infant botulism. At least 15 babies in 12 states have been sickened in the outbreak since August, with more cases pending.
2016–2021 Honda Civics
Honda has recalled over 400,000 of its 2016–2021 Civics due to an increased risk of crash or injury. A manufacturing error may cause wheels to come off the vehicle while moving.
Tesla Powerwall 2 AC Battery Power System
Tesla is recalling its Powerwall 2 AC Battery Power Systems due to a risk of serious injury or death from fire and burn hazards. The lithium-ion battery cells in certain Powerwall 2 systems can cause the unit to stop functioning during normal use, which can result in overheating and, in some cases, smoke or flame.
Zigjoy Toddler Sleep Sacks with Feet
Zigjoy has recalled its sleep sacks with feet due to a risk of serious injury or death from a burn hazard. The recalled sleep sacks violate the mandatory flammability standard for children’s sleepwear.
Portable Power Banks and Wireless Charging Stands
Belkin is recalling its portable power banks and wireless charging stands due to fire and burn hazards. The lithium-ion battery in the power banks and charging stands can overheat.
Great Lakes Select Button Cell and Coin Batteries
Great Lakes Wholesale International has recalled select battery packs due to a risk of battery ingestion. The button cell and lithium coin batteries are not in child-resistant packaging and do not bear warning labels.
Trek and Electra-branded Bicycles With Coaster Brakes and Replacement Rear Wheels With Coaster Brakes
Trek is recalling its bicycles with coaster brakes and replacement rear wheels due to a crash hazard. The coaster brakes can fail to engage, resulting in the rider losing control.
Zippee Activity Toys
Mobi Games has recalled its Zippee Silicone Activity Toys due to a risk of serious injury or death from choking. The recalled silicone activity toys contain spherical ends that can reach the back of the throat.
Bettina Doll Set With Magic Light Unicorn
Shantou Chenghai Xingzigu Toy Industry is recalling its Bettina Doll Sets due to a risk of serious injury or death from battery ingestion. The battery compartment of the unicorn contains button cell batteries that can be easily accessed by children.
Toyota Tundra and Lexus Vehicles
Toyota is recalling 126,691 Tundra and Lexus models due to an increased risk of crash or injury. “Machining debris" may not have been removed from the cars' engines during manufacturing, which could cause the engines not to start or to turn off while driving.
The impacted vehicles include:
- Toyota Tundra, Model Year 2022–2024
- Lexus LX600, Model Year 2022–2024
- Lexus GX550, Model Year 2024
